Halkidiki enjoys a Mediterranean climate with h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ters. Its position between the Thermaic Gulf and the Aegean creates ideal conditions for seaside holidays from May through October.
| Month | Air °C | Sea °C | Rain mm | Sunshine hrs | Wind |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| January | 5-10 | 13 | 45 | 3 | Moderate |
| February | 6-11 | 13 | 40 | 4 | Moderate |
| March | 8-14 | 14 | 40 | 5 | Moderate |
| April | 12-19 | 16 | 35 | 7 | Light |
| May | 17-25 | 19 | 30 | 9 | Light |
| June | 22-30 | 23 | 20 | 11 | Light |
| July | 25-33 | 25 | 10 | 12 | Light |
| August | 25-33 | 26 | 10 | 11 | Light |
| September | 21-28 | 24 | 25 | 9 | Light |
| October | 15-22 | 20 | 45 | 6 | Moderate |
| November | 10-16 | 17 | 55 | 4 | Moderate |
| December | 6-12 | 15 | 50 | 3 | Moderate |
Sithonia tends to be 1-2°C cooler than Kassandra due to denser pine forest cover. The Vardaris (north wind) can bring sudden cool spells even in July.
Summer (June–September) for beaches and swimming. July–August is peak. May, early June, or September give great weather with fewer crowds and 30–50% lower prices.
Fly to Thessaloniki (SKG), then 1–2 hours by car. Car rental from ~€25/day. Alternatively bus (KTEL Halkidiki), but schedules are limited. Detailed routes in /from guides.
